Parenting Tips for Cheongam Folk Museum

  • A private folk museum opened in 1999, located at the beginning of the Yangju Jangheung Recreation Area, making it relatively easy to find.
  • From the colorful sculptures at the entrance to the indoor and outdoor retro sights to see, it's a folk museum filled with sights.
  • The indoor exhibition hall has a variety of retro items, making it a great place to visit with grandparents.
  • The outdoor yard has old buildings recreated and courtyard and table, traditional play facilities where children can run around.
  • There is a wide dedicated parking lot opposite the building.
  • After viewing the museum, show your ticket to get a discount at the museum cafe and pizza place right next door.

Cheongam Folk Museum

Cheongam Folk Museum is a retro museum where you and your child can vividly experience traditional everyday culture from the past. For parents, it can feel like a trip down memory lane, while for kids, it is full of unfamiliar and fascinating things to see along with traditional folk games, making it a great place for a family outing.

Exhibition and experience highlights

Inside, you will find a variety of everyday items and retro exhibits, making it a nice place for different generations to explore together. In the outdoor yard, there is a recreated old-style building area, plenty of open space where kids can run around, and traditional folk play facilities, so it is easy to enjoy spending more time here even after viewing the exhibits.

Why it is great to visit with kids

  • The children's admission fee is 3,000 won for ages 3 and up.
  • There are many exhibits that are enjoyable and relatable even when visiting with grandparents.
  • From the entrance, you will find colorful sculptures and photo spots that are great for taking family pictures.

Things to check before your visit

  • Operating hours are 10:00-18:00.
  • There is a dedicated parking lot, so visiting by car is convenient.
  • Baby chairs, a nursing room, a diaper changing table, stroller rental, and reservations are not provided.
  • If you show your admission ticket after visiting the museum, you can receive a discount at the museum cafe and pizza restaurant right next door.

FAQ about Cheongam Folk Museum

  • Does Cheongam Folk Museum have a space where children can play?
    Yes. In the outdoor yard at Cheongam Folk Museum, there are traditional folk play facilities such as seesaw jumping, jegichagi, tuho, and spinning tops, so kids can run around and have fun.
  • From what age does Cheongam Folk Museum charge admission for children?
    The children's rate at Cheongam Folk Museum applies from age 3 and up, and the admission fee is 3,000 won. The adult admission fee is 5,000 won.
  • Does Cheongam Folk Museum have good photo spots for taking pictures with children?
    Yes. Cheongam Folk Museum has colorful sculptures at the entrance and an outdoor recreated old-style building area, making it great for family photos. It has also been confirmed that you can borrow old-style school uniforms, hats, and bags for free to take commemorative photos.
  • Does Cheongam Folk Museum have a nursing room or a diaper changing table?
    Based on confirmed information, Cheongam Folk Museum does not have a nursing room or a diaper changing table. It is also indicated that baby chairs and stroller rental are not provided.
  • What are the operating hours and closed days for Cheongam Folk Museum?
    Cheongam Folk Museum is open daily from 10:00 to 18:00. However, it is confirmed to be closed on the first, third, and fourth Monday of every month, so it is a good idea to check once more before your visit.
  • Where is the parking lot at Cheongam Folk Museum?
    There is a large dedicated parking lot across from Cheongam Folk Museum, so visiting by car is convenient. It is available free of charge, and there is also information indicating that accessible parking spaces are provided.
  • Is Cheongam Folk Museum comfortable to get around with a stroller?
    Cheongam Folk Museum is known to have some areas inside without thresholds, and accessible facilities are also provided, so getting around with a stroller is generally not too inconvenient. However, some areas may still be difficult to access.
  • Is Cheongam Folk Museum easy to reach by public transportation?
    Yes. From Gupabal Station, you can take bus 350 or 351 and get off at the Cheongam Folk Museum stop. From Ganeung Station, you can take bus 360, get off at Jangheung Nonghyup Front, and then walk for about 5 to 10 minutes.
  • Are there places to eat near Cheongam Folk Museum after visiting?
    Yes. Right next to Cheongam Folk Museum, there is a restaurant that sells pizza, spaghetti, and other menu items, and if you show your museum admission ticket, you can receive a discount.
